Quick answer

Saraura is a village in Pilibhit Tehsil of Pilibhit district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 131559.

About Saraura village record

Saraura is listed under Pilibhit Tehsil in Pilibhit district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 582, 106 households, area 102.12 hectares, PIN code 262001.
